Abstract:
A process for increasing the levels of polyphenolic acid release into coffee which is brewed from beans which are bathed in an aqueous, basic solution shortly after roasting. The same process is applied to other polyphenolics containing beverage substrates, including teas. The bathing of beverage substrates (coffee beans and tea leaves, for example) with the aqueous agent does not adversely change the taste of the produced beverage, and, in fact, in the case of coffee, such process actually extends the apparent freshness of coffee by inhibiting in the condensation of tannins in the coffee brew, thereby providing, not only the health benefits of the elevated levels of polyphenols, but a means to extend the freshness of the brewed beverage.

Abstract:
The invention is of both a composition and method for inhibiting the proliferation of cancerous cells. The composition is, and the method is based on the use of a composition consisting (among active ingredients) substantially of 2-methoxyestradiol and/or one of a number of analogues thereof. The present inventors have demonstrated beyond serious doubt that these compounds have a pronounced effect in inhibiting the proliferation of cancerous cells and, therefore, provide a desperately needed stepping stone for advancing toward meaningful treatment of cancer.
